    Fresh Trouble for IPL Founder Lalit Modi as Vanuatu Revokes His Citizenship Request |

    The vanuatu government has revised the passport ised to Indian Premier League (IPL) This decision follows Recent International Media Reports suggesting that modi was attempting to avoid extraction to India.

    The Prime Minister’s Office is issued a statement explaining that when modi applied for Vanuatu Citizenship, Interpol Had Rejected Two Requests to ISSUE An alert Against Him. Furthermore, Modi’s Background Check Had Shown No Criminal Convictions, Which LED to the Initial Approve of His Vanuatu Passport.

    PM Napat Emphahsized that Holding a Vanuatu Passport is a Privilege, Not A Right. He stated that applicants must seek citizenship for legitimate reasons.

    Lalit Modi had applied to surrender his Indian passport after Acquiring Vanuatu Citizenship.

    Indian Government’s Response

    On March 7, in Response to reports of modi obtaining vanuatu citizenship, ministry of external affairs speakesperson randhir jaiswal confirmed that the Indian government was united Surrender his Indian passport at the High Commission in London.

    “We are Continuing to Pursue All Cases Against Him as Per The Law,” Jaiswal Stated. He added that the government would examine Modi’s citizenship acquisition in accordance with existing rules.

    Modi’s comments on the issue

    Lalit Modi, Currently Resident in London, Denied The Charges Against Him. In a post on social media platform x (formerly twitter) on March 8, He Claimed, “No court of law in India has a case pending aganst me personally. It’s only media fiction. ” He continued, “Fifteen years have gone. But they keep saying we are going after me … this is called fake news. ”

    Modi also defended his actions, stating, “The only thing that I have done single-handedly is create a globally loved product called ipl.”

    Lalit Modi’s Alleged Crimes

    Lalit Modi, who served as the Vice-PREDENT of the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I), has been accused of serial crimes. These include alleged bid-rigging, money laundering, and violations of the Foreign Exchange Management Act, 1999 (FEMA). Modi left India in 2010 while under Investigation for Financial Misconduct, Including Unauthorized Fund Transfers.
